The Server Administrator Instrumentation Service allows you to manage
BMC features, such as, general BMC information, configuration of the LAN
and serial port, BMC users, and BIOS setup. To use Server Administrator to
configure the BMC on a managed system, perform the following steps:
NOTE:
You must be logged in with Admin privileges to configure the BMC settings.
1
Log in to the Server Administrator home page for the target system.
2
Click the
System
object.
3
Click the
Main System Chassis
object.
4
Click the
Remote Access
object.
5
The
BMC Information
window is displayed.
6
Click the
Configuration
tab.
Under the
Configuration
tab, you can configure LAN, Serial Port, and
Serial Over LAN.
7
Click the
Users
tab.
Under the
Users
tab, you can modify the BMC user configuration.
NOTICE:
A password must be set for each BMC user. The BMC firmware does not
allow access to users with null user names or passwords.
Configuring BIOS in Server Administrator
To configure BIOS in Server Administrator, complete the following steps:
1
Click the
System
object.
2
Click the
Main System Chassis
object.
3
Click the
BIOS
object.
4
Click the
Setup
tab.
In the
Setup
tab, you can configure
Console Redirection
and
Serial Port
communication
parameters.
